Y así es como haces el código asíncrono dentro del código síncrono en un hook de React. Las Especificaciones de Requerimientos son un documento clave en el desarrollo de Software. Cuando consideramos los ciclos de vida clásicos, tiene la descripción completa de lo que va a hacer el sistema sin describir cómo lo va a hacer. Las pruebas de picos aplican subidas y bajadas extremas y repentinas de carga para determinar el comportamiento de las aplicaciones durante picos de tráfico. Su objetivo es evaluar si el rendimiento se puede ver afectado por cargas inesperadas y si el sistema es capaz de soportar cambios de carga bruscos. Hacer actividades de prueba al principio del ciclo ayuda a mantener el esfuerzo de prueba al principio en lugar de después del desarrollo.
- Trabajo para un grupo llamado Microsoft Industry AI.
- La mayoría de software utilizan recursos externos como API o sistemas de terceros.
- Pero obviamente en el próximo, si lo usas, deberías cambiarlo por Wave 4.
- La automatización es clave para hacer esto posible, y escribir pruebas antes o después pasará a formar parte de tu workflow de desarrollo.
- Pueden ejecutar pruebas mucho antes en el ciclo para descubrir defectos antes, cuando resultan más fáciles de corregir.
Es posible que un tester solo tenga una pequeña ventana para probar el código, a veces justo antes de que la aplicación salga al mercado. Si se encuentran defectos, puede haber poco tiempo para volver a codificar o volver a probar. No es raro lanzar el software a tiempo, pero con errores y correcciones necesarias. O un equipo de pruebas puede corregir errores pero perder una fecha de lanzamiento. Las aplicaciones de software son enormes por naturaleza y es un desafío probar todo el sistema. Puede dar lugar a muchas lagunas en la cobertura de la prueba.
Pruebas Funcionales
Creo que me estoy quedando sin tiempo. Entonces, para la cobertura, ¿80% https://www.sutori.com/en/user/dgd-fgdfg-ccf3 o 90%, cuál es mejor? Mi consejo es nada más del 80% para la cobertura.
- Las pruebas de humo son pruebas básicas que sirven para comprobar el funcionamiento básico de la aplicación.
- Realizó cálculos matemáticos utilizando instrucciones de código de máquina.
- Entonces, en esta masterclass, voy a hacer una demostración de un componente muy simple llamado Películas.
- Y nadie querrá siquiera intentar meterse con ello.
- En cuanto a las pruebas del tipo no funcional, se podrían considerar pruebas de rendimiento, pruebas de stress, pruebas de fiabilidad, entre otras.
Al realizar las pruebas de integración, se examina cómo funciona el software completo como una unidad, tal y como lo hará cuando la gente lo utilice. El enfoque basado en el contexto implica examinar el entorno preciso en el que se utilizará el producto. Reconoce que el funcionamiento del software depende de algo más que de sus componentes. Los módulos de búsqueda de vuelos, pago y confirmación se someten a pruebas unitarias para garantizar que funcionan según lo previsto.
Tipos de Pruebas
La prueba de componentes puede tener en cuenta la verificación de características funcionales o no funcionales específicas de los componentes del sistema. Una aplicación se puede pensar en una combinación e integración de muchos pequeños módulos individuales. Antes de probar todo el sistema, es imperativo que cada componente O la unidad más pequeña de la aplicación se pruebe a fondo. Las https://dreevoo.com/profile.php?pid=623466 a veces también se conocen como pruebas de programas o módulos. Un componente es la unidad más baja de cualquier aplicación. Entonces, prueba de componentes; como sugiere el nombre, es una técnica de prueba de la unidad más baja o más pequeña de cualquier aplicación.
Son el tipo de pruebas que se realizan sin ejecutar el código de la aplicación. Las pruebas de estabilidad se usan para determinar el rendimiento y estabilidad de las aplicaciones a lo largo del tiempo. Verifican que https://pl.enrollbusiness.com/BusinessProfile/6624193/curso%20de%20data%20science la aplicación funcione correctamente durante períodos de tiempo más largos de actividad continua. Ya que a veces una aplicación puede funcionar bien durante unas horas antes de empezar a experimentar algún problema.
Tipos de pruebas de rendimiento
Sin embargo, no todas las pruebas son iguales. En este artículo veremos en qué se diferencian algunas prácticas de pruebas. Donde puedes afirmar como cualquier prueba, cualquier sintaxis normal.